Verified facts

What the public records show

CMS Open Payments records show Robin S Hynek, ARNP received $52.56 in general payments during 2025 across 3 reported records.

Collegium Pharmaceutical, Inc. accounted for 66.6% of that reported general-payment amount.

The Open Payments records used for this analysis explicitly named 2 associated products.

Collegium Pharmaceutical, Inc. reported payments to this doctor in 2025. Across the 2025 Open Payments General Payment records loaded for this analysis, that same reporting entity reported BELBUCA as an associated drug or biological on 17475 records involving 4385 distinct recipient NPIs. Public Medicare Part D data also shows 12 claims for Belbuca by this doctor in 2024.

These records do not establish that a payment influenced prescribing or medical care.
